Discrete Dynamics in Nature and Society | 2010

A Hybrid Method for a Countable Family of Multivalued Maps, Equilibrium Problems, and Variational Inequality Problems

Watcharaporn Cholamjiak

We introduce a new monotone hybrid iterative scheme for finding a common element of the set of common fixed points of a countable family of nonexpansive multivalued maps, the set of solutions of variational inequality problem, and the set of the solutions of the equilibrium problem in a Hilbert space. Strong convergence theorems of the purposed iteration are established.


Computers & Mathematics With Applications | 2011

Approximation of common fixed points of two quasi-nonexpansive multi-valued maps in Banach spaces

Watcharaporn Cholamjiak

In this paper, we introduce and study two new iterative procedures with errors for two quasi-nonexpansive multi-valued maps in Banach spaces. Strong convergence theorems of the proposed iterations to a common fixed point of two quasi-nonexpansive multi-valued maps in uniformly convex Banach spaces are established.

Computers & Mathematics With Applications | 2010

Weak and strong convergence theorems for a finite family of generalized asymptotically quasi-nonexpansive mappings

Watcharaporn Cholamjiak

In this paper, we introduce a new iterative scheme for finding a common fixed point of a finite family of generalized asymptotically quasi-nonexpansive mappings in a uniformly convex Banach space. We establish weak and strong convergence theorems. Our main results improve and extend the corresponding ones obtained in Schu (1991) [J. Schu, Iterative construction of fixed points of asymptotically nonexpansive mapping, J. Math. Anal. Appl. 159 (1991) 407-413] and many others.


Abstract and Applied Analysis | 2009

Monotone Hybrid Projection Algorithms for an Infinitely Countable Family of Lipschitz Generalized Asymptotically Quasi-Nonexpansive Mappings

Watcharaporn Cholamjiak

We prove a weak convergence theorem of the modified Mann iteration process for a uniformly Lipschitzian and generalized asymptotically quasi-nonexpansive mapping in a uniformly convex Banach space. We also introduce two kinds of new monotone hybrid methods and obtain strong convergence theorems for an infinitely countable family of uniformly Lipschitzian and generalized asymptotically quasi-nonexpansive mappings in a Hilbert space. The results improve and extend the corresponding ones announced by Kim and Xu (2006) and Nakajo and Takahashi (2003).


Numerical Algorithms | 2018

A modified S-iteration process for G-nonexpansive mappings in Banach spaces with graphs

Raweerote Suparatulatorn; Watcharaporn Cholamjiak

In this work, we prove the weak and strong convergence of a sequence generated by a modified S-iteration process for finding a common fixed point of two G-nonexpansive mappings in a uniformly convex Banach space with a directed graph. We also give some numerical examples for supporting our main theorem and compare convergence rate between the studied iteration and the Ishikawa iteration.

Communications of The Korean Mathematical Society | 2013

A HYBRID METHOD FOR A COUNTABLE FAMILY OF LIPSCHITZ GENERALIZED ASYMPTOTICALLY QUASI-NONEXPANSIVE MAPPINGS AND AN EQUILIBRIUM PROBLEM

Prasit Cholamjiak; Watcharaporn Cholamjiak

In this paper, we introduce a new iterative scheme for finding a common element of the fixed points set of a countable family of uni- formly Lipschitzian generalized asymptotically quasi-nonexpansive map- pings and the solutions set of equilibrium problems. Some strong con- vergence theorems of the proposed iterative scheme are established by using the concept of W-mappings of a countable family of uniformly Lip- schitzian generalized asymptotically quasi-nonexpansive mappings.
